The Itinerary Breakdown

The tour kicks off with a visit to the Garden of the Sleeping Giant, which is arguably the highlight for plant lovers and photography enthusiasts alike. Known for its extensive collection of orchids, this garden is a feast for the eyes. The tranquil pathways wind through lush foliage, with many trees and flowers that make for perfect photo moments. Travelers often mention how peaceful and beautifully maintained the gardens are, ideal for a gentle walk or some meditative downtime.

What to expect: Expect a professional guide to lead the way, sharing stories about the garden’s history and plant species. Reviewers have praised guides like “the guide was very knowledgeable and friendly,” enhancing the visit with personal insights. You’ll spend about an hour here, with plenty of opportunities to photograph the vibrant orchids and tropical scenery.

Next, your journey continues to the Sabeto Hot Springs and Mud Pool, located conveniently between Nadi and Lautoka. The hot springs are famed for their sulphur-rich waters—a feature locals believe has healing properties. The mud baths, with their thick, mineral-laden mud, promise both a fun and therapeutic experience, known for self-cleansing and natural rejuvenation.

What to expect: The guided tour emphasizes the relaxing and rejuvenating benefits of the hot springs and mud pools. Many reviewers noted that “the mud baths are a must-try,” and appreciated the family-friendly, serene atmosphere. You might find the experience a bit messy but in a good way—wear the provided robes or swimwear and prepare for some playful splashing.

Practical Aspects and Value

The tour’s price—about $61.15 per person—includes all fees, taxes, transportation, and a professional guide. This makes it quite accessible compared to standalone garden or hot spring visits, especially considering the inclusivity of transport and guided insights.

Transport is air-conditioned and comfortable, with hotel pickup and drop-off, eliminating the need to navigate unfamiliar routes. The tour lasts roughly 3 to 4 hours, making it an ideal half-day activity—perfect for travelers who want a taste of Fiji’s natural wonders without dedicating an entire day.

Note: Lunch isn’t included, so plan your meal around the tour or bring snacks. The flexible cancellation policy (free if canceled 24 hours in advance) adds peace of mind, giving travelers confidence in booking.

FAQ

Garden of Sleeping Giant with Sabeto Hotspring Mudpool Tour - FAQ

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, the tour includes pickup and drop-off from your hotel on Denarau Island, making it a hassle-free experience.

How long does the tour last?
The entire experience takes approximately 3 to 4 hours, combining garden visits, hot springs, and optional massage.

What is included in the price?
All fees, taxes, transportation in an air-conditioned vehicle, and a professional guide are included. Admission tickets to the garden and hot springs are also covered.

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, cancellations are free if made at least 24 hours before the scheduled start, providing flexibility for your trip plans.

Is this tour suitable for families?
Absolutely. The environment is family-friendly and the activities are suitable for most age groups, especially if they enjoy nature and water activities.

What should I wear or bring?
Comfortable clothing suitable for walking and getting a little muddy is recommended. Swimwear or robes are provided for the mud baths. Don’t forget sunscreen and a towel if you plan to shower afterward.

Is the tour accessible for people with mobility issues?
While the tour is generally suitable for most, the uneven pathways in the gardens and around the hot springs may pose a challenge for some individuals with mobility difficulties.

Are meals included?
No, lunch is not included, so plan accordingly before or after the tour.
